ORDER TO SHOW CAUSE: 1. Xu filed the instant petition on April 20, 2026, requesting that Respondents Craig A. Lowe, Todd Lyons, Markwayne Mullin, and Todd Blanche (together Respondents) release him from custody at the Pike County Correctional Facility in Lords Valley, Pennsylvania. (Doc. 1). 2. According to Xu, Respondents have detained him under 8 U.S.C. § 1231 for more than six months with no credible plan for removal. (Doc. 1, at 12). 3. Xu avers that his continued detention past the presumptively reasonable six-month removal period violates § 1231 as interpreted by Zadvydas v. Davis, 533 U.S. 678 (2001) and the Due Process Clause of the Fifth Amendment. (Doc. 1, at 11-12). 4. Courts in the Third Circuit have found that petitioners are entitled to supervised release when they sufficiently establish their removal is not reasonably foreseeable and their detention has exceeded the period necessary to secure their removal. 5.
